Show Menu
主题×

transactionID

集成数据源使用交易 ID 将离线数据绑定至在线交易(如在线生成的商机或购买)。
每个发送到 Adobe 的唯一 transactionID 均会被记录,以备该交易离线信息的数据源上载。请参阅 数据源
最大大小
调试程序参数
填充报表
默认值
100 字节
xact
不适用
""
启用交易 ID 存储
在记录 transactionID 值之前,必须为报表包管理器中选中的报表包启用交易 ID 存储。此设置位于
Analytics > Admin > Report Suites > Edit Settings > General > General Account Settings.

要查看是否为报表包启用了 transactionID Storage ,请转到
Analytics > Admin > Data Sources > Manage

语法和可能值
s.transactionID="unique_id"

transactionID 只能包含字母数字字符。如果在一次点击中记录多个 transactionID,可使用逗号分隔多个值。
示例
s.transactionID="11123456"

s.transactionID="lead_12345xyz"

s.transactionID=s.purchaseID

缺陷、问题和提示
  • 如果未启用 transactionID 记录,则 transactionID 的值将会丢失,无法与集成数据源一起使用。确保在设置了 transactionID 的页面上设置转化变量或事件(eVar 或事件变量)。否则,将不会为 transactionID .
  • 如果您要记录多个系统(例如购买和商机)的 transactionIDs,请确保 transactionID 中的值始终是唯一的。可通过向 ID 添加前缀(例如 lead_1234 和 purchase_1234)来达到这一目的。如果某个独特 transactionID 出现两次,则集成数据源不能按预期工作(数据源数据将绑定到错误的数据)。
  • 默认情况下, transactionID 值将会保留 90 天。如果离线互动过程的时间超过 90 天,请联系客户关怀延长该期限。
transactionID 变量可以包含逗号以外的任何字符。它应在指定字符限制(100 字节)的相同位置。如果使用多字节字符,则必须启用多字节字符支持,以避免 transactionID